PATRICK BLANC


Patrick Blanc, the esteemed French botanist, scientist and designer, pioneered the concept of the vertical garden wall, an innovative technique for growing plants on vertical surfaces without the use of soil and which can exist with little human interference. His work can be seen on walls from Europe to India, to South Korea to Thailand and Japan to the USA. His most public displays grace Musee du Quai Branly, the Pershing Hall Hotel and the Ministry of Culture in Paris. The largest installation is the vertical garden of the Caixa Forum in Madrid. Patrick selects plants for their ability to live together using an average of 500 species per piece. His work at Sea Sentosa will be a wonderful example of this global phenomenon.
